Taliban bans broadcast of IPL due to “anti-Islamic content”

The Taliban will not allow the broadcast of IPL 2021 due to possible "anti-Islam contents" that could air during the programming. Anti-Islamic content refers to girls dancing and the attendance of women without hijab in the IPL series.

After New Zealand, England cancels cricket tours of Pakistan

Rawalpindi was due to host men's and women's Twenty20 double-headers on October 13 and 14, however, the England and Wales Cricket Board said in a statement that it had "reluctantly decided to withdraw both teams from the October trip."

Why is Iran’s nuclear program back in spotlight?

Since May 2019, Iran has announced successive breaches in reaction to US President Trump's withdrawal from the agreement in 2018 and the reimposition of harsh sanctions on Iran. According to the latest report, Iran has now amassed a stockpile of 2,441.3 kilograms.

SBP decides to raise the key interest rate

The State Bank of Pakistan's Monetary Policy Committee has decided to increase the policy rate of the country for the next two months by 25 points basis to 7.25 per cent. This according to the statement is in line with the positive economic recovery.
